Page 4: ...sleep mode In order to do this you will need to do the following If the engine is cold open the hood close the doors lock the car and wait 30 seconds If the engine is warm open the hood close the doors lock the car and wait 20 minutes If the engine is warm and you can t wait 20 minutes disconnect the battery Figure A 2 1 REMOVAL ...

Page 17: ...tting The LED on the switch represents the different level of power Green LED Stock Yellow LED Sport Orange LED Sport Red LED Race Use the grey button to select the desired setting Power adjustments can be done at any time while the unit is on The LED switch can be used at the same time as the Bluetooth app Figure N ...
